学位论文 > 优秀研究生学位论文题录展示

船载噪声源系统的设计与实现

作 者: 顾文金
导 师: 王大成
学 校: 哈尔滨工程大学
专 业: 电子与通信工程
关键词: PC/104 FPGA VHDL 舰船辐射噪声信号模拟
分类号: U665
类 型: 硕士论文
年 份: 2011年
下 载: 33次
引 用: 1次
阅 读: 论文下载
 

内容摘要


本文给出的船载噪声源系统主要由电台、PC/104工控机、数据采集板、信号发射板、继电器板、存储设备、功率放大器、匹配网络、电声换能器组成。电台用于接收远程控制端的指令。PC/104工控机是船载噪声源系统的主控模块,PC/104工控机使用串口接收电台的指令和向电台回传船载噪声源系统的状态信息。PC/104工控机根据串口接收的不同的指令,控制船载噪声源系统主要实现以下的功能:发射远程控制端指令要求的指定形式的声信号,信号可以是舰船模拟噪声或者是单频信号;PC/104工控机与存储设备进行预置波形文件的读取和监控记录数据的存储;PC/104工控机可以通过控制继电器开关来控制功率放大器工作,当不需要功率放大器工作时,关闭功率放大器电源,延长电源的使用时间。论文的主要研究工作包括船载噪声源系统的硬件设计和系统软件程序的设计。其中硬件设计主要是PC/104工控机与FPGA和D/A转换器组成的信号发射模块电路的设计。软件设计是PC/104工控机的C语言程序设计和FPGA的VHDL语言程序设计。本系统已通过了实际的海上测试,测试结果证明,该系统性能可靠,程序稳定。

全文目录


摘要  5-6
ABSTRACT  6-9
第1章 绪论  9-13
  1.1 论文的目的和意义  9
  1.2 船载噪声源系统的历史及现状  9-12
  1.3 本文研究的主要内容  12-13
第2章 船载噪声源系统的总体设计  13-21
  2.1 系统的总体框架结构  13-14
  2.2 舰船噪声模拟信号的产生  14
  2.3 系统功能描述  14-15
    2.3.1 系统主要功能  14
    2.3.2 系统各模块主要功能  14-15
  2.4 系统的技术指标  15
  2.5 系统各模块器件选型  15-20
    2.5.1 指令接收控制模块  15-17
    2.5.2 信号采集模块  17-18
    2.5.3 继电器模块  18-19
    2.5.4 信号发射模块  19-20
  2.6 系统的各部分连接  20
  2.7 本章小结  20-21
第3章 系统的硬件电路设计  21-29
  3.1 FPGA芯片电路设计  21-22
  3.2 FPGA电源电路设计  22
  3.3 FPGA的JTAG接口电路和配置芯片电路设计  22-23
  3.4 D/A转换器芯片选取和电路设计  23-25
    3.4.1 D/A转换芯片重要参数  23-24
    3.4.2 本文选取的D/A转换器电路设计  24-25
  3.5 模拟滤波器选取和电路设计  25-27
    3.5.1 模拟滤波器重要参数  25-26
    3.5.2 本文选用的模拟滤波器的电路设计  26-27
  3.6 系统电源电路设计  27
  3.7 电路PCB设计中去耦电容放置  27-28
  3.8 本章小结  28-29
第4章 系统的软件设计  29-48
  4.1 PC/104工控主机程序要实现的功能  29
  4.2 PC/104工控机C语言程序设计  29
  4.3 C语言程序流程图及说明  29-41
    4.3.1 C语言总流程图  29-33
    4.3.2 串口通信程序流程图  33-34
    4.3.3 发射单频信号程序流程  34-36
    4.3.4 发射噪声信号程序流程  36-37
    4.3.5 数据采集板数据采集程序流程图  37-38
    4.3.6 自检程序流程  38-39
    4.3.7 发射曳光管流程  39
    4.3.8 PC/104与FPGA板通信程序流程  39-41
  4.4 本文VHDL程序设计  41-46
    4.4.1 PC/104与FPGA芯片通信的VHDL程序设计  41-42
    4.4.2 数据缓存模块设计思想与技巧  42-43
    4.4.3 D/A芯片控制与RAM读操作的VHDL程序设计  43-46
    4.4.4 RAM写操作的VHDL程序设计  46
  4.5 软件程序中断设计  46-47
  4.6 本章小结  47-48
第5章 系统的调试与实验分析  48-60
  5.1 系统调试的思路  48
  5.2 硬件电路调试  48
  5.3 软件程序调试  48-49
  5.4 串口程序调试  49
  5.5 信号采集板的程序调试  49-50
  5.6 继电器模块的程序调试  50
  5.7 信号发射模块的C语言调试和VHDL程序的调试  50-58
  5.8 系统的综合调试  58-59
  5.9 本章小结  59-60
结论  60-61
参考文献  61-64
攻读硕士学位期间发表的论文和取得的科研成果  64-65
致谢  65-66
附录  66-67

相似论文

  1. 基于FPGA的电磁超声检测系统的研究,TH878.2
  2. 基于FPGA的五相PMSM驱动控制系统的研究,TM341
  3. LXI任意波形发生器研制,TM935
  4. 直扩系统抗多径性能分析及补偿方法研究,TN914.42
  5. 电视制导系统中视频图像压缩优化设计及实现研究,TN919.81
  6. 基于FPGA的数字图像处理基本算法研究与实现,TP391.41
  7. 基于FPGA的高速图像预处理技术的研究,TP391.41
  8. LXI计数器研制,TP274
  9. FPGA系统远程安全升级的设计与实现,TP309
  10. 谐振式光纤陀螺数字信号检测系统设计与实现,V241.5
  11. 基于FPGA的标清数字电视音频层叠加嵌系统的研究与设计,TN941.2
  12. 高效无刷直流电机控制系统的设计与研究,TM33
  13. 基于VxWorks的观瞄控制系统研究,TP273
  14. 基于PCI总线数据采集系统的研究与设计,TP274.2
  15. SRAM型FPGA单粒子故障传播特性与测试方法研究,V467
  16. 面阵CCD的图像采集与信号传输的研究,TN386.5
  17. 云计算背景下基于FPGA的文件管理系统与Web缓存的紧耦合研究与分析,TP333
  18. 8PSK+TCM编码调制解调技术,TN915.05
  19. 海杂波建模仿真技术研究与FPGA实现,TN955
  20. DBF权重处理电路的设计与实现,TN957.51
  21. 双路摄像头多帧率编码单元的硬件设计与实现,TN919.81

中图分类: > 交通运输 > 水路运输 > 船舶工程 > 船舶电气设备、观通设备
© 2012 www.xueweilunwen.com